How Vegetables Typically Combat Inflammation

Most vegetables contain powerful antioxidants like flavonoids, carotenoids, and polyphenols. These compounds neutralize free radicals—unstable molecules that damage cells and trigger inflammation. For example:

    • Leafy greens like spinach and kale are loaded with vitamin K and magnesium, both known for anti-inflammatory properties.
    • Cruciferous vegetables such as broccoli and Brussels sprouts contain sulforaphane, a compound shown to reduce inflammatory markers.
    • Root vegetables like carrots provide beta-carotene, an antioxidant that may lower inflammation risks.

Fiber in vegetables also plays a vital role by supporting gut health. A healthy gut microbiome regulates immune function and reduces systemic inflammation. Fiber acts as fuel for beneficial bacteria, helping produce short-chain fatty acids like butyrate that soothe intestinal lining.

In numerous clinical studies, diets rich in vegetables correlate with lower levels of C-reactive protein (CRP), a marker of inflammation. This evidence backs the widespread recommendation to consume abundant veggies daily for chronic disease prevention.

Which Vegetables Might Trigger Inflammation?

Despite their benefits, not all vegetables are innocent bystanders when it comes to inflammation. Some contain natural irritants or compounds that may provoke immune responses in sensitive individuals.

Nightshade Vegetables

The nightshade family includes tomatoes, potatoes (white), eggplants, bell peppers, and chili peppers. These veggies contain alkaloids such as solanine and capsaicin that can irritate the digestive tract or trigger inflammatory reactions in some people.

For example:

    • Solanine, found in potatoes and eggplants, may worsen symptoms of arthritis or autoimmune conditions in certain individuals.
    • Capsaicin, the spicy compound in chili peppers, can cause localized inflammation or discomfort if consumed excessively.

However, this does not mean nightshades cause inflammation universally. Many tolerate them without issues; problems arise mostly among those with autoimmune diseases or gut sensitivities.

Oxalate-Rich Vegetables

Oxalates are naturally occurring compounds found in foods like spinach, beet greens, Swiss chard, rhubarb, and some nuts. High oxalate intake can contribute to kidney stone formation but may also irritate tissues causing mild inflammatory responses in susceptible people.

While oxalates themselves don’t directly cause systemic inflammation for most individuals, excessive consumption combined with poor hydration or gut issues might aggravate inflammatory symptoms locally.

Allergic Reactions to Specific Veggies

Some people have allergies or intolerances to particular vegetables causing immune activation and inflammation. Symptoms vary from mild digestive upset to severe allergic reactions involving swelling or skin irritation.

Common vegetable allergens include celery, carrots (especially raw), parsley, fennel seeds, and certain legumes like peas or beans classified botanically as vegetables.

The Role of Preparation Methods on Vegetable-Induced Inflammation

How you prepare your veggies matters greatly when considering their inflammatory potential. Cooking methods influence nutrient availability as well as formation of pro-inflammatory compounds.

    • Raw vs Cooked: Raw vegetables retain more vitamin C but may be harder to digest for some people causing gut irritation.
    • Overcooking: Excessive heat destroys antioxidants reducing anti-inflammatory benefits.
    • Frying: Frying vegetables introduces unhealthy fats and advanced glycation end products (AGEs) that promote inflammation.
    • Souring/fermentation: Fermented veggies like sauerkraut boost beneficial bacteria aiding anti-inflammatory effects.

Choosing steaming or light sautéing preserves nutrients without generating harmful substances while improving digestibility for many individuals.

The Impact of Individual Differences on Vegetable-Induced Inflammation

No two bodies respond identically to food. Genetics play a role in how the immune system reacts to certain vegetable compounds. For instance:

    • Celiac disease patients: May experience heightened gut inflammation triggered by certain vegetable fibers combined with gluten exposure.
    • Lupus sufferers: Might react adversely to nightshades worsening joint pain.
    • Irritable bowel syndrome (IBS): Some fermentable fibers from veggies can cause bloating or discomfort mimicking inflammatory symptoms without true immune activation.

Gut microbiome diversity also influences digestion efficiency of plant fibers and phytochemicals affecting inflammatory balance systemically.

The Science Behind Anti-Inflammatory Diets Featuring Vegetables

Diets recognized for reducing chronic inflammation—like the Mediterranean diet—feature abundant vegetable consumption alongside fruits, whole grains, nuts, olive oil, fish rich in omega-3 fatty acids.

Research shows these patterns lower biomarkers such as interleukin-6 (IL-6) and tumor necrosis factor-alpha (TNF-α), key drivers of systemic inflammation linked with cardiovascular disease risk reduction.

Clinical trials consistently find higher vegetable intake correlates with reduced incidence of inflammatory diseases including rheumatoid arthritis flare-ups and metabolic syndrome components such as insulin resistance.
